Comprehending the Two-Tier Licence System
The United Kingdom operates a two-tier driving licence system that reflects a driver's experience level and screening status. The provisionary driving licence represents the student's permit, enabling individuals to practice driving under particular conditions, while the full driving licence licenses that the holder has actually shown proficiency and might drive individually.
The provisional driving licence functions as the initial step for all learner motorists. This document permits holders to drive a vehicle on public roads, however just when accompanied by a certified driver who has actually held a full licence for a minimum of three years. The accompanying driver needs to be aged 21 or older and need to not be driving under the influence of alcohol or drugs. Provisionary licence holders are also restricted from driving on motorways unless taking part in an approved driving trainer's specific freeway training course.
The complete driving licence, obtained after successfully completing both the theory and useful driving tests, eliminates all these limitations. Holders might drive without supervision, usage motorways freely, and delight in the full advantages of car in the UK and throughout the European Economic Area. Understanding this distinction shows vital for anyone starting their journey toward certified driving.

The Step-by-Step Process to Obtaining Your LicenceUsing for Your Provisional Licence
The journey begins with acquiring a provisionary driving licence. Application can be completed online through the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) website or by completing the D1 paper application available at Post Office branches. Applicants should offer identity paperwork, including a legitimate passport, and pay the application cost. The DVLA will photograph the applicant for the licence, so those using online must either upload a digital photograph or visit a picked Post Office branch for the picture to be taken.
Processing usually takes around one to two weeks for online applications and up to three weeks for paper applications. As soon as authorized, the provisionary licence arrives by post, and the holder may immediately start the learning procedure. Importantly, the provisional licence stands for up to 10 years, offering students sufficient time to get ready for and pass their tests.
Preparing for and Passing the Theory Test
Before scheduling any driving lessons, learners must pass the theory test, which makes up two components: a multiple-choice evaluation and a hazard perception test. The multiple-choice section tests knowledge of the Highway Code, roadway signs, lorry safety, and general driving theory. The risk understanding assessment assesses the applicant's ability to determine and react to establishing hazards on the roadway.
Preparation for the theory test need to include studying the current edition of The Highway Code, practicing with official revision products, and finishing numerous mock tests. Numerous students discover that dedicated modification applications and website tools help enhance understanding and build self-confidence before trying the actual test. The theory test expenses ₤ 23 and must be passed in the past booking the useful driving test.

The Practical Driving Test
The useful driving test represents the culmination of the learning procedure. Throughout the test, an examiner assesses the candidate's ability to drive securely and effectively in numerous road and traffic conditions. The test consists of an eyesight check, vehicle safety concerns, and approximately 40 minutes of driving that includes various maneuvers and independent driving sections.
Test cancellations and waiting times differ considerably by location and time of year, so scheduling the test well in advance shows recommended. The current charge for the useful driving test stands at ₤ 62 for weekdays and ₤ 75 for weekend visits. Must the candidate stop working, they need to wait a minimum of 10 working days before reattempting the test.

Health and vision requirements likewise warrant attention before beginning the process. Candidates need to satisfy minimum eyesight requirements, having the ability to read a car number plate from 20 metres away with corrective lenses if necessary. Certain medical conditions might affect eligibility to drive or need additional documents from a physician. The DVLA provides comprehensive guidance on medical conditions that may affect driving, and individuals with issues must evaluate this details before making an application for their provisionary licence.

Can I drive with my provisionary licence on freeways?
Provisionary licence holders might not drive on motorways unless getting involved in particular motorway driving lessons with an approved driving instructor. However, legislation has actually been proposed to allow monitored motorway driving for learners, so inspecting existing guidelines with the DVSA remains advisable.
What takes place if I fail my driving test?
Failure does not need beginning over. Candidates might rebook the test after an obligatory 10-working-day waiting period. The DVSA recommends additional lessons or a refresher course before reattempting the test to deal with any weaknesses recognized by the examiner.
Do I require to restore my driving licence once I turn 70?
Full driving licences stay legitimate till the holder reaches age 70, after which renewal is needed every 3 years. No test is needed for renewal, however applicants should verify their continued fitness to drive.
